Status

On the DS230 form, Part I, section 25 it asks about all trips to the US and what type of visa you were on. We included our current stay in the US as per our lawyers instructions, so my husbands put that he had been in the US from Apr. 1999 to present on an H-1B. I assume she got the info from there.

We also sent photocopies of all pages of our passport with Packet 3, so she could also have seen it there.

St. Louis

That\'s the address I sent my P3. My understanding is that the sole purpose of the St. Louis step is to collect the check that\'s inside the package, hence maybe why somebody from a bank signed for it. I would check the status of the check in a couple of days. After this, the package is forwarded to New Hampshire. It\'s only at this point where they will tell you if it has been received.

Two weeks after you\'ve mailed it, called the NVC. They are really nice on the phone and extremely helpful. The review won\'t be complete for another 4-6 weeks.

Plastic Card Received 5/1, Entry Date 4/12

For those interested:

CP Successful 4/9
POE: Ottawa (INS Preclearance at Airport) 4/12
Plastic Card Received: 5/1 from Texas Service Center (TSC)

I was surprised as I figured my card would come from VSC where I had GC paperwork processed (I work in Metro DC area). Possibly card issuance is based upon geographic POE, not regional center where paperwork was done.

So to answer the question posed by some in this forum, I received my plastic card in about 2.5 weeks (including transit time from Texas, postmarked 4/29). MUCH faster than I expected. I would speculate its possible that certain POEs (with lower volume) are able to forward on completed/processed entry visas faster to the regional service centers for data entry and card issuance.
 
Cards

All CPIV Permanent Resident Cards come from the TSC. 2.5 weeks is excellent. I have been reading that 3-4 weeks is typical for CPIV. A friend who had his AOS passport stamp 3 months ago is still waiting for the card. Brian.
